The Giovi Pass (Italian: Passo dei Giovi [ˈpasso dei ˈdʒoːvi]; Ligurian: Passo di Zoi [ˈpasːu di ˈzuːi]) is a pass in Italy in the northwestern Ligurian Apennines north of Genoa.

Geography

The pass is at 472 metres (1,548 feet).[1]

A railroad from Genoa to Turin and Milan runs through the pass via a tunnel that is 1,686 metres (5,531 feet) long.[2]

Hiking

The pass is also accessible by off-road mountain paths and is crossed by the Alta Via dei Monti Liguri, a long-distance trail from Ventimiglia (province of Imperia) to Bolano (province of La Spezia).[3]
